Rumah  >  Artikel  >  pembangunan bahagian belakang  >  Bagaimana untuk Menyesuaikan CSS untuk Penyemak Imbas Tertentu: Mozilla, Chrome dan IE?

Bagaimana untuk Menyesuaikan CSS untuk Penyemak Imbas Tertentu: Mozilla, Chrome dan IE?

Barbara Streisand
Barbara Streisandasal
2024-10-21 13:01:31606semak imbas

How to Customize CSS for Specific Browsers: Mozilla, Chrome, and IE?

Menyesuaikan CSS untuk Penyemak Imbas Tertentu: Mozilla, Chrome dan IE

Pernyataan bersyarat CSS membenarkan pembangun menggunakan peraturan CSS khusus berdasarkan penyemak imbas pengguna. Walaupun coretan kod yang disediakan cuba mencapai perkara ini, ia memerlukan pemurnian lanjut.

Mengenal pasti Penyemak Imbas

Untuk menyesuaikan CSS untuk penyemak imbas tertentu, anda boleh menggunakan kaedah berikut:

  • Pengimbasan Ejen Pengguna: Kesan rentetan ejen pengguna dan kenal pasti penyemak imbas serta versinya.
  • Css Hacks: Gunakan CSS khusus kod yang menyasarkan penyemak imbas tertentu.
  • Skrip atau Pemalam: Gunakan skrip atau pemalam untuk mengenal pasti penyemak imbas dan gunakan kelas dinamik pada elemen.

PHP untuk CSS Dinamik

PHP boleh digunakan untuk mencipta fail CSS dinamik berdasarkan penyemak imbas yang dikesan. Fungsi seperti get-browser boleh memberikan maklumat tentang penyemak imbas dan versinya.

Css Hacks for Selectivity Browser

Berikut ialah senarai contoh hacks CSS untuk penyasaran penyemak imbas tertentu :

<code class="css">/* IE6 and below */
* html #uno  { color: red }

/* IE7 */
*:first-child+html #dos { color: red } 

/* IE7, FF, Saf, Opera  */
html>body #tres { color: red }

/* Everything but IE 6,7 */
html>/**/body #cuatro { color: red }</code>

Plugin untuk Pengenalan Penyemak Imbas

Jika pemalam lebih disukai, pertimbangkan untuk menggunakan alatan seperti:

  • https://rafael .adm.br/css_browser_selector/

Ingat, walaupun kaedah ini boleh membantu dengan penggayaan khusus penyemak imbas, adalah penting untuk mengutamakan kebolehaksesan dan keserasian merentas penyemak imbas untuk pengalaman pengguna yang optimum.

Atas ialah kandungan terperinci Bagaimana untuk Menyesuaikan CSS untuk Penyemak Imbas Tertentu: Mozilla, Chrome dan IE?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n